To understand what leaders truly need to thrive today, Waterstone surveyed over 140 executives, CEOs, and CPOs across various industries. Their message was unmistakable. Leadership development matters more than ever, yet most organizations are not doing enough to support it.

What Leaders Need Most
The survey identified the capabilities that leaders believe will define success over the next three to five years.
- Strategic Thinking & Execution (69% rated “Extremely Valuable”)
- Emotional Intelligence & Communication (67%)
- Building High-Performance Teams (66%)
- Leading Through Change & Uncertainty (58%)
- Driving Growth & Innovation (55%)
These capabilities influence performance, culture, and organizational agility. They also reflect where many leaders feel stretched and underprepared.
What Is Getting in the Way
Organizations want to develop their leaders, yet they face real constraints.
- Competing priorities (69%)
- Time away from role (64%)
- Budget constraints (43%)
- Lack of alignment with organizational strategy (15%)
- Limited evidence of ROI (12%)
Most leaders can be away from their role for only two to six days each year. The majority of organizations prefer hybrid learning that blends structure with flexibility. Leadership development must fit inside the rhythm of the business and still be meaningful.
When Companies Decide to Invest
Organizations are more likely to invest in leadership development when programs offer the following:
- Tangible organizational impact measurement (73%)
- Leadership assessments and 360° feedback (60%)
- Succession readiness (65%)
- Coaching components (57%)
- Recognition by respected national programs (40%)
Companies want confidence that development will matter and that they will see measurable results.
